Уменьшение ошибок в GBM

Я хотел бы знать, как ErrorReduction рассчитывается в функции pretty.gbm.tree: https://github.com/gbm-developers/gbm3/blob/62c8dafd87b16fe1d2079cdd5058169f1f08967b/R/pretty-gbm-tree.r#L32

Этот пост мне очень помог, но не совсем ответил на мой вопрос. Понимание древовидной структуры в пакете R gbm

Вот вывод функции pretty.gbm.tree для первого дерева: таблица вывода

Как рассчитывалось это значение 19167,524?

Спасибо

1 ответ

Решение

ErrorReduction рассчитывается следующим образом:

количество выборок в текущем узле * mse - количество выборок в левом дочернем узле * mse - количество выборок в правом дочернем узле * mse

Другие вопросы по тегам